Understanding the Emirates Visa for Chinese Citizens
The Emirates Visa allows Chinese citizens to legally enter and stay in the UAE for tourism, business, or transit purposes. The eVisa system, introduced by the UAE government, simplifies the entire visa process. Applicants can now apply online without visiting any embassy, avoiding long queues and manual paperwork.
Chinese citizens simply need to complete an online application, upload documents, and receive the approved eVisa via email. This electronic visa must be printed and carried while traveling, serving as proof of legal entry.
Types of Emirates Visa Available for Chinese Passport Holders
Chinese nationals can apply for multiple categories of Emirates Visas depending on their travel purpose and duration.
Tourist Visa
The tourist visa is ideal for leisure travelers who wish to explore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and other Emirates. It is available in 14-day, 30-day, and 60-day durations with options for single or multiple entries.
Transit Visa
Transit visas (48-hour and 96-hour options) are designed for Chinese travelers passing through UAE airports. This is a perfect choice for short stopovers or connecting flights with Emirates Airlines.
Business and Long-Term Visas
For entrepreneurs, investors, and professionals, business and long-term visit visas offer extended validity and flexibility. Supporting documents such as invitation letters or business licenses are required.
Emirates Visa Requirements for Chinese Citizens
Chinese citizens applying for an Emirates Visa must prepare the following documents:
-
Valid passport (minimum 6 months validity from travel date)
-
Recent passport-size photograph with white background
-
Completed Emirates Visa application form
-
Confirmed flight booking (to and from UAE)
-
Proof of accommodation (hotel booking or host invitation)
-
Financial proof such as recent bank statements or salary slips
-
If applicable, Emirates ID of UAE resident sponsor
Additional Notes:
Business or long-term visa applications may require additional documents like a company invitation, trade license, or educational certificates for professionals.

Processing Time for Emirates Visa from China
The average processing time for Chinese citizens is 1 to 3 business days, provided all documents are submitted correctly. However, delays may occur during UAE public holidays or major events. It’s advisable to apply at least one week before travel to avoid last-minute issues.

Overstay Fines and Penalties for Chinese Citizens in the UAE
Tourist and Visit Visa Overstay Fines
-
10-day grace period after visa expiry
-
AED 200 for the first day of overstay
-
AED 50 per additional day
-
AED 100 administrative service charge
Residence Visa Overstay Fines
-
30-day grace period after visa cancellation or expiry
-
AED 125 for the first day of overstay
-
AED 50 for each subsequent day
-
AED 100 daily fine after one year
To avoid penalties, apply for a visa extension or exit the UAE before the grace period ends.
Common Reasons for Visa Rejection and How to Avoid Them
-
Incomplete or incorrect application form
-
Blurred passport or photograph
-
Invalid or expired passport
-
Inconsistent travel purpose and visa type
-
Pending UAE immigration fines
✅ Tip: Always double-check details and ensure documents are clear and up-to-date before submission.
